The passage investigates the evolution of research methodologies from manual compilation to digital automation. It highlights how software tools allow researchers to handle vast datasets, run complex simulations, and minimize human error. Key Themes Covered:
This passage generally discusses three main categories of software: (like EndNote), Qualitative Analysis Software (like NUD*IST or NVivo), and Statistical Software (like SPSS).
